94.23 percent of the population in 48150 drive to work alone. 0.26 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 64.60 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 5.28 percent of the residents in 48150 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.54 members with about 2.26 cars available per household.
An estimate of 95.28 percent of the residents in 48150 has some form of health insurance. 28.27 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 81.41 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 48150 would have to travel an average of 0.80 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, St Joe Mercy Hospital System Livonia .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 48150, Livonia, Michigan.

As of , an estimate of 27,153 residents live in 48150 with a median age of 40.1 years. 19.05 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 16.08 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 40.14 percent of the residents in 48150 is currently married, and 21.69 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 48150 is $8,247.08.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 48150 is approximately $1,151. The median household spends about 13.96 percent of their income on housing.

Arthritis is a common condition that causes pain and inflammation in the joints. It can be debilitating for those who suffer from it, making access to quality healthcare vital for managing symptoms and improving overall quality of life. Individuals with arthritis often require regular check-ups, medication management, and access to specialists such as rheumatologists and physical therapists.
